Reporting Period: 2022
Environmental Metrics

- Information Security
Environmental Achievements
- Reduced coating shop VOCs emissions by 7.5% over 2021
- Reduced effluent discharge by 5.6% over 2021
- Reduced water consumption by 5,500t/year
- Built self-use PV installations at 536.5 kW to reduce emissions by about 309.9tCO2e/year

Reporting Period: 2023
Environmental Metrics
ESG Focus Areas
- Climate Change
- Energy Conservation
- Carbon Reduction
- Water Conservation
- Waste Reduction
- Biodiversity
- Supply Chain Sustainability
- Employee Well-being
- Corporate Governance
- Social Responsibility
- Community Engagement
Environmental Achievements
- Reduced carbon emissions by 10.19% across Scope 1 and Scope 2 categories since 2018.
- Became the first automotive company in Taiwan to commit to the Science-Based Targets initiative (SBTi).
- Implemented Internal Carbon Pricing (ICP) of NTD 1,039/tCO2e.
- Reduced VOC emissions by 3% compared to 2021 levels.
- Reduced effluent volume by 16.37% compared to 2022.
- Achieved a 59.5% recycling rate for packaging materials.

Climate Goals & Targets
- Achieve net-zero carbon emissions by 2050.
- Install 13,282.5 kW of solar power capacity by 2040, with renewable energy accounting for 55% of total electricity.
- Achieve 50% carbon reduction compared to 2018 by 2040.
- Install approximately 5,993.5 kW of solar power capacity by 2030, with renewable energy accounting for 25% of total electricity.
- Reduce water consumption by 140 tons annually by 2024.
- Expand carbon reduction practices to assist suppliers with greenhouse gas inventories by 2027.
- Achieve 30% carbon reduction compared to 2018 by 2030.
